The Video Game Industry in a Troubled State

Challenges and Concerns

The video game industry has been facing a tumultuous period, with studio closures and job security at the forefront of developer concerns. The past year has seen a surge in layoffs, with no end in sight, painting a bleak picture for the future of the industry. Despite this, companies are investing heavily in AI initiatives, leaving many developers feeling uncertain about their place in the industry.

AI in the Industry

According to a recent report from the Game Developers Conference (GDC), 52% of developers surveyed stated that they work for companies using generative AI in their games. However, half of the 3,000 respondents expressed concern about the technology’s impact on the industry, and an increasing number reported feeling negatively about AI overall.

Industry Trends and Sentiment

The GDC’s "State of the Game Industry" report, released in March, reveals a mix of cultural and economic factors affecting the industry. Despite the success of games like Astro Bot, Helldivers 2, and Balatro, studios like Microsoft and Sony have slashed staff and canceled games. The report also highlights the growing unease among developers about the ethics of AI technology.

Developer Feedback

One developer with a PhD in AI, who worked on developing some of the algorithms used by generative AI, expressed regret over their contributions, stating, "I deeply regret how naively I offered up my contributions."

Negative Sentiment Towards AI

The survey revealed that 30% of developers felt negatively about AI, a significant increase from 18% last year. Only 13% believed AI was having a positive impact on games, down from 21% in 2024. Many developers expressed concerns about the potential negative impact of AI on the industry, with one developer stating, "No matter how you put it, generative AI isn’t a great replacement for real people, and quality will be damaged."

Uses of AI in the Industry

While AI has the potential to help with tasks such as coding, concept art, and 3D model generation, developers were skeptical about its uses in the industry. When asked about the potential uses of AI, "the word used most frequently in their responses was ‘none.’"

Working Hours and Layoffs

Despite the potential benefits of AI, developers are reportedly working longer hours than ever. Thirteen percent of respondents reported working 51+ hour weeks, up from 8% last year. Many developers attributed this to the need to take on additional work to make up for colleagues lost in massive industry-wide layoffs.

NVIDIA AI Reduces Road Delays and Emissions

Taming Traffic in Tuscon, Vancouver and Beyond

More than 90 million new vehicles are introduced to roads across the globe every year, leading to an annual 12% increase in traffic congestion — according to NoTraffic, a member of the NVIDIA Inception program for cutting-edge startups and the NVIDIA Metropolis vision AI ecosystem.

Reducing Unnecessary Congestion and Delays

Still, 99% of the world’s traffic signals run on fixed timing plans, leading to unnecessary congestion and delays. To reduce such inefficiencies, NoTraffic’s AI Mobility platform predicts road scenarios, helps ensure continuous traffic flow, minimizes stops, and optimizes safety at intersections across the U.S., Canada, and elsewhere.

How NoTraffic’s AI Mobility Platform Works

The platform, which enables road infrastructure management at both local-intersection and city-grid scale, integrates NVIDIA-powered software and hardware at the edge, under a cloud-based operating system. It’s built using the NVIDIA Jetson edge AI platform, NVIDIA accelerated computing, and the NVIDIA Metropolis vision AI developer stack.

Success Stories

In Tuscon, Arizona, more than 80 intersections are tapping into the NoTraffic AI Mobility platform, which has enabled up to a 46% reduction in road delays during rush hours — and a half-mile reduction in peak queue length. In Vancouver, Canada, the University of British Columbia (UBC) is using the NoTraffic platform and Rogers Communications’ 5G-connected, AI-enabled smart-traffic platform to reduce both pedestrian delays and greenhouse gas emissions.

Benefits of NoTraffic’s AI Mobility Platform

  • Reduces travel times, saving drivers over $1.6 million in gas and cutting emissions, resulting in the equivalent impact of planting 650,000 trees
  • Frees up to 1.25 million hours of traffic time, representing an economic benefit of over $24.3 million
  • Reduces red-light runners by nearly 80%, improving safety at intersections
  • Decreases pedestrian delays by up to 40%

Balenciaga’s Ugly Game Console

0

The Balenciaga Console: A Retro Gaming Disaster

The great Spanish fashion designer Cristóbal Balenciaga will be rolling in his grave this week. The Kering-owned brand that uses his name today has made a handheld retro gaming console – and it’s as hideous as you might expect.

A Cross Between a Nintendo Game Boy and a Tesla Cybertruck

The Balenciaga console looks like a cross between a Nintendo Game Boy and a Tesla Cybertruck done on the cheap. If anything the limited-edition device reinforces the argument that gaming and hype fashion really don’t mix. One of the best retro games consoles it is not.

A Gift for Important Chinese Customers

The Balenciaga gaming console has been made as a gift for important Chinese customers (or VICs) to celebrate the lunar new year and the start of the Year of the Snake. Yes, you guessed it. The console plays the classic mobile game Snake (which is also available to play online at the Balenciaga website.) And that’s all it does.

Watch the Console in Action

Balenciaga Snake Game – YouTube

A Cheap, Plastic Console with Impactically Shaped Buttons

Just like a Balenciaga T-shirt, the console takes minimalism to its blandest extreme, resulting in a product that looks like a cheap generic with a logo stamped on it. It’s plasticy, has impactically shaped buttons, and, out of the box, it only plays Snake, although I presume someone will find a way to play DOOM on it.

Hype Fashion and Gaming Don’t Mix

These days, much of what Balenciaga does is can be described as hype fashion, the complete opposite of Cristóbal’s traditional approach to haute couture with his emphasis on craftmanship. But, as the Gucci Xbox has already shown us, hype fashion and gaming just don’t work. I wonder how impressed those Chinese VIC’s will be with this dubious New Year gift. They might prefer to wait for the Nintendo Switch 2 release.

Donald Trump Rescinds Biden-Era Executive Order on AI Safety

0

Trump Rescinds Biden’s Executive Order on Generative AI Safety Guidelines

In his executive actions on day one of his presidency, Donald Trump rescinded an executive order Joe Biden signed in 2023 to establish safety guidelines for generative AI.

Biden’s Original Order: Safety Guidelines for Generative AI

The Biden-era order required developers of large AI models like OpenAI’s GPT lineup to share the results of safety tests with the US government. It also directed the National Institute of Standards and Technology to develop standards for safety testing, and it tasked other federal agencies with assessing any potential chemical, biological, radiological, nuclear, cybersecurity, or critical infrastructure risks AI might pose.

Biden’s Action on Worker and Consumer Protection

Biden’s action also included measures meant to protect workers and consumers. It commissioned a report on how AI might affect the labor market and asked agencies to develop practices for addressing AI-enabled fraud and discriminatory algorithms.

Trump’s Rescission of the Order

Donald Trump axed all that yesterday as he signed a flurry of new executive orders. One of his first actions was to rescind 78 Biden-era executive actions, including Executive Order 14110 on “Safe, Secure, and Trustworthy Development and Use of Artificial Intelligence.”

What’s Next for AI Development in the US?

Other measures the Biden administration put in place to boost AI development in the US may have a better shot at surviving. Before leaving office this month, Biden announced a new regulatory framework restricting some international sharing of AI chips and models. Biden also issued an executive order in January meant to speed the development of AI data centers on federal land.

Mainframe Application Modernization Drives Digital Transformation

0

Digital Transformation and Mainframe Modernization

Rapid advancement of emerging technologies—combined with the increasing demands from customers and ongoing disruptive market forces—are driving organizations to prioritize digital transformation more than ever. According to a recent survey conducted by the IBM Institute for Business Value in cooperation with Oxford Economics, 67% of executive respondents say their organizations need to transform quickly to keep up with the competition, while 57% report current market disruptions are placing unprecedented pressure on their IT.

The Need for Digital Transformation

Digital transformation places significant demands on existing applications and data, which necessitates modernization and integration across an enterprise’s heterogeneous technology landscape, including cloud and mainframe. It’s no wonder that CEOs ranked technology modernization as one of their top priorities for their organizations as they look to reinvent products, services, and operations in order to improve efficiency, agility, and time to market.

The Role of Mainframe in Digital Transformation

Enterprises need flexible, secure, open, and fit-for-purpose platforms to operate and develop services consistently across their hybrid cloud environment. The mainframe remains a critical component in achieving this, as mission-critical applications continue to leverage the strength of mainframes. A hybrid best-fit approach is one that includes mainframes and cloud, supporting the modernization, integration, and deployment of applications. This maximizes business agility and addresses client pain points, including reducing the talent gap, accelerating time to market, improved access to mission-critical data across platforms, and optimizing costs.

Mainframe Modernization: Challenges and Opportunities

The new research from the IBM Institute for Business Value found that nearly 7 in 10 IT executives say mainframe-based applications are central to their business and technology strategies. On top of that, 68% of respondents say mainframe systems are central to their hybrid cloud strategy.

However, modernization can be a complex process, with organizations facing a host of challenges. Almost 70% of executives surveyed report that the mainframe-based applications in their organizations need to be modernized. The study further reveals that organizations are 12x more likely to leverage existing mainframe assets rather than rebuild their application estates from scratch in the next two years, which could be too costly, risky, or time-consuming. For those businesses now pursuing mainframe application modernization, surveyed executives point to the lack of required resources and skills as the top challenge. Mainframe costs, which executives cited as a significant barrier when asked two years ago, is no longer perceived as such, with executives now looking for more sources of value from mainframe such as resilience, optimization, and regulatory compliance.

Actionable Steps for Mainframe Modernization

Given the importance of mainframe modernization, IT leaders looking to reinvigorate their mainframe modernization need to take a few critical actions now:

Adopt an Iterative Approach

As part of your plan to integrate new and existing environments, factor in your industry and workload attributes. Partner with your business counterparts to co-create a business case and a “best-fit” roadmap designed to meet your strategic goals. Adopt an incremental and continuous approach to modernization instead of a big bang, rip, and replace.

Assess Your Portfolio and Build Your Roadmap

Examine the capabilities that define the role of the mainframe in your enterprise today and how those capabilities tie into the greater hybrid cloud technology ecosystem. In addition, prioritize cross-skilling within the organization and lean on your partners to make up for new or existing talent and resource gaps.

Leverage Multiple Application Modernization Entry Points

Help enable easy access to existing mainframe applications and data by using APIs. Provide a common developer experience by integrating open-source tools and a streamlined process for agility. Develop cloud-native applications on the mainframe and containerize applications.

Winter X Games to Test AI Judging for Snowboarding

0

X Games Introduces AI Judge to Enhance Snowboarding Competition

At this year’s winter X Games in Aspen, Colo., judges will be joined by an artificial intelligence (AI) judge to evaluate snowboarders’ performances in the SuperPipe competition.

How AI Will Assist Judges

The AI system will analyze video footage of each athlete’s run, providing a score based on their tricks, flips, and grabs. While human judges will still determine the official scores and award medals, the AI evaluation will be displayed on TV and online, allowing commentators and audiences to see the AI’s assessment.

AI’s Potential Impact on Judging

Jeremy Bloom, the chief executive of X Games and a former freestyle skier, sees AI as a potential “superpower” for judges. “I would say sometimes humans make mistakes,” Mr. Bloom said. “That’s not to say the AI won’t make mistakes, too, especially in this early form, but our goal is to give this tool to judges, so that they can use it in their booth.”

Technology in Sports

The use of technology in sports is becoming increasingly common, with applications such as electronic calls in tennis, cameras making offside rulings in soccer, and automated strike zones in baseball.

Potential Applications Beyond Snowboarding

The Judging Support System has already been used in gymnastics’ world championships, and AI could potentially be used in a range of judged events, including diving, surfing, and breakdancing. The International Olympic Committee has recognized the potential benefits of AI in judging, citing its ability to reduce human bias and offer real-time analysis.

Future of Judging

While AI has the potential to improve the accuracy of judging, Jeremy Bloom does not believe it will replace human judges entirely. “I don’t think so, personally,” Mr. Bloom said. “But I do think that AI in partnership with judges can bring more objectivity to subjective sports, and that’s what’s really important to me.”
